Alginate is slightly soluble in water and insoluble in most organic solvents. It is dissolved in alkaline solution, so that the solution is viscous. Sodium alginate alginate is hygroscopic and the amount of moisture contained in the equilibrium depends on the relative humidity. The dried sodium alginate is stored fairly stable in a well-sealed container at 25 ° C and below. Sodium alginate solution is stable at pH 5 to 9. The degree of polymerization (DP) and the molecular weight are directly related to the viscosity of the sodium alginate solution, and the decrease in viscosity during storage can be used to estimate the degree of sodium alginate de-polymerization. High degree of polymerization of sodium alginate stability is less than the degree of polymerization of sodium alginate. It is reported that sodium alginate can be catalyzed by proton hydrolysis, which depends on time, pH and temperature. The propylene glycol alginate solution is stable at room temperature at pH 3 to 4; when the pH is less than 2 or greater than 6, the viscosity will decrease even at room temperature. The sodium powder is wet with water and the hydration of the particles makes the surface sticky. The particles are then quickly bonded together to form clumps, and the agglomerates are slowly and completely hydrated and dissolved. Alginate is more difficult to dissolve in water if it contains other compounds that compete with alginate for hydration. Water in the sugar, starch or protein will reduce the rate of sodium alginate hydration, mixing time necessary to extend. A monovalent cation (such as NaCl) also has a similar effect at concentrations above 0.5%. The pH of sodium alginate in 1% distilled water was about 7.2....
